Thursday we arrived into Lesotho. The people in Drakensberg told us we would never make it there in a day - but we did it anyway! It’s a beautiful, mountainous country with over 2 million people and completely landlocked within South Africa. Over 50% of the population is involved in agriculture - but Lesotho also has significant diamond and water resources. We were very pumped for our visit.
